About the Congregation for Sacred Practices:

Congregation for Sacred Practices is a 501(c)3 religious organization that works with sacred plant medicines to offer healing and spiritual guidance to those on the awakening path. We hold these sacraments in the highest regard and foster a community of respect, love, and curiosity.
